Automakers showcase in-car leisure choices at CES

STORY: From BMW’s new color-changing car to Sony’s long-awaited push into electric vehicles, automakers showed off their next-generation vehicles at the CES 2023 technology trade show in Las Vegas. In particular…how they are reshaping the in-car entertainment experience. As autonomous driving capabilities improve, car brands are following Tesla by offering video streaming and even gaming. […]
